Vilamovian

Etymology

From Old High German ein, from Proto-Germanic *ainaz, from Proto-Indo-European *óynos. Compare Low German en, ein, Dutch een, English one, Danish en, Norwegian Nynorsk ein.

Numeral

ǡ m or n

  1. one

Article

ǡ m or n

  1. a, an
